Factors to Consider for Each Room
When identifying the appropriate paint coating for every area, it is essential to think about various elements such as lighting, website traffic, and wanted atmosphere. Lights plays a crucial role in exactly how paint colors appear. Areas with enough natural light can handle bolder finishes, while dimly lit areas might take advantage of lighter surfaces to improve illumination.
High-traffic areas like hallways and children's spaces call for resilient surfaces that can withstand frequent cleaning and wear. On house painters exterior , bed rooms and living spaces can suit softer surfaces for a more extravagant feel.
Additionally, the desired ambiance of each space affects the choice of paint finish. For areas planned for relaxation, such as rooms or checking out nooks, matte or eggshell surfaces produce a soothing atmosphere. In contrast, high-gloss surfaces are perfect for areas like kitchens and bathrooms where a reflective surface can enhance cleanliness and brightness.
Best Paint Finishes for Kitchens
Considering the special needs of kitchen atmospheres, choosing one of the most appropriate paint surface is critical to making sure both longevity and visual charm in this high-traffic location. Kitchens are prone to high levels of humidity, oil, and constant cleansing, making resilience a leading priority when choosing a paint finish. For kitchens, the best paint surfaces are typically semi-gloss or satin.
Semi-gloss paint surfaces are a popular choice for kitchen areas as a result of their sturdiness and simplicity of cleansing. They are immune to wetness, oil, and stains, making them suitable for areas susceptible to dashes and spills. Furthermore, semi-gloss surfaces give a refined shine that reflects light, brightening up the space and making it feel a lot more open.
Satin coatings are an additional excellent choice for kitchens as they offer a smooth, silky appearance that is very easy to tidy and keep. Satin finishes are likewise immune to mold, making them appropriate for the moisture typically existing in kitchens.
Choosing the Right End Up for Bathrooms
Selecting the appropriate paint coating for restrooms needs cautious factor to consider of elements such as moisture resistance and convenience of maintenance. Due to the high moisture and regular exposure to water in shower rooms, it is vital to choose a paint coating that can endure these problems.
The most effective paint coatings for bathrooms are typically semi-gloss or satin finishes. Semi-gloss paint is a preferred option for washrooms due to its toughness and wetness resistance. It is simple to tidy, making it ideal for rooms susceptible to dashes and wetness. The shiny coating additionally aids to reflect light, cheering up the space.
Satin coating is one more exceptional choice for shower rooms as it strikes an equilibrium in between matte and gloss. It supplies a subtle sheen that is very easy to clean and resistant to wetness. Satin coating is perfect for restrooms where a less glossy look is preferred while still giving defense versus water damages.
